Article: Inovest and Tharawat plan $32m company.

MANAMA: Bahrain-based Inovest and Tharawat Investment House are planning to set up a $32 million water filter production company within a year.

The Bahrain Water Technology Company (BWTC) will be set up through a $24m equity investment plus $8m through financing.

The company will produce water filters that can be used by households, commercially and for desalination projects.

The development which is a first of its kind initiative in Bahrain, comes in response to pressing water scarcity issues in the GCC and Mena region.
